Auto merge of #16317 - eloycoto:issue6799, r=emilio
Fix #6799: set stacking_context_position correctly on fragment_border_iterator Hey, First of all, this is my first PR to Servo project and I'm learning Rust, so sorry if you see something that it's not correct. I did that as best as I know. This PR fix the issue #6799; I tried all the corner cases that I can think about it and always get the right result and the same as other browsers. Related to the build: - [x] `./mach build -d` does not report any errors - [x] `./mach test-tidy` does not report any errors - [x] These changes fix #6799 In the other hand, I added the test in the cssom folder, is where getBoundingClientRect is defined, so I think that is the best place. I'm sure that the line 122 can be better, but I didn't find a way to transform a Point2D from f32 to px in a easy way. I'm here to listen to your recommendations and fix any issue.
